Overview
The Schafter V12 is a Grand Theft Auto sedan modelled on the Mercedes-Benz E/S-Class and built in-game by Benefactor. It has been part of the series since GTA Online (2015).
It follows the Mercedes-Benz executive-sedan template.
History in the GTA Series
The Schafter line is Benefactor's Mercedes-style sedan range; the V12 is the high-performance version. Benefactor is Rockstar's Mercedes-Benz brand, and armoured Schafters have appeared as well.
The Benefactor Connection
Inside GTA's fiction the Schafter V12 carries the Benefactor badge. Rockstar's in-game manufacturers are parody brands of real-world marques — a way the series builds a recognisable car world without licensing real names — and the Benefactor stable is where this vehicle sits.
